Ossian to offer supremely golden support to Horsecross

Ossian, InveralmondBrewery’s flagship beer brand, has today announced a commercial partnership with Horsecross Arts in a deal that will see the beer profiled as a leading sponsor of the arts organisation, as well as providing a selection of their most popular beers at Perth Concert Hall for visitors to enjoy.
Continuing to grow in its appeal internationally, with beers brewed in Perth being sold as far away as China, Inveralmond Brewery are excited to be collaborating with Horsecross Arts whose cultural programme attracts artists and audiences from around the globe.

To toast the partnership, Inveralmond Brewery’s Managing Director Fergus Clark and Louisa Evans, Business Development Manager of Horsecross Arts, officially welcomed Inveralmond’s most popular brew Ossian to Perth Concert Hall. The friendly pint shared between the two celebrates the beginning of a year of sponsorship with Horsecross Arts with Inveralmond Brewery proudly lending their commercial support to the burgeoning creative arts scene in the Perth.
